Lines Matching refs:cb_node

484         auto cb_node = GetCBNode(pCommandBuffers[i]);  in GpuPreCallRecordFreeCommandBuffers()  local
485 if (cb_node) { in GpuPreCallRecordFreeCommandBuffers()
486 for (auto &buffer_info : cb_node->gpu_buffer_list) { in GpuPreCallRecordFreeCommandBuffers()
495 cb_node->gpu_buffer_list.clear(); in GpuPreCallRecordFreeCommandBuffers()
724 …ommonMessage(const debug_report_data *report_data, const GLOBAL_CB_NODE *cb_node, const uint32_t *… in GenerateCommonMessage() argument
731 << LookupDebugUtilsName(report_data, HandleToUint64(cb_node->commandBuffer)) << "(" in GenerateCommonMessage()
732 << HandleToUint64(cb_node->commandBuffer) << "). "; in GenerateCommonMessage()
736 << LookupDebugUtilsName(report_data, HandleToUint64(cb_node->commandBuffer)) << "(" in GenerateCommonMessage()
737 << HandleToUint64(cb_node->commandBuffer) << "). " in GenerateCommonMessage()
964 void CoreChecks::AnalyzeAndReportError(const layer_data *dev_data, GLOBAL_CB_NODE *cb_node, VkQueue… in AnalyzeAndReportError() argument
1004 …GenerateCommonMessage(report_data, cb_node, debug_record, shader_module_handle, pipeline_handle, d… in AnalyzeAndReportError()
1016 …:ProcessInstrumentationBuffer(const layer_data *dev_data, VkQueue queue, GLOBAL_CB_NODE *cb_node) { in ProcessInstrumentationBuffer() argument
1018 if (cb_node && cb_node->hasDrawCmd && cb_node->gpu_buffer_list.size() > 0) { in ProcessInstrumentationBuffer()
1022 for (auto &buffer_info : cb_node->gpu_buffer_list) { in ProcessInstrumentationBuffer()
1032 …result = GetDispatchTable()->MapMemory(cb_node->device, buffer_info.mem_block.memory, block_offset… in ProcessInstrumentationBuffer()
1036 … AnalyzeAndReportError(dev_data, cb_node, queue, draw_index, (uint32_t *)(pData + offset_to_data)); in ProcessInstrumentationBuffer()
1037 GetDispatchTable()->UnmapMemory(cb_node->device, buffer_info.mem_block.memory); in ProcessInstrumentationBuffer()
1137 auto cb_node = GetCBNode(submit->pCommandBuffers[i]); in GpuPostCallQueueSubmit() local
1138 ProcessInstrumentationBuffer(dev_data, queue, cb_node); in GpuPostCallQueueSubmit()
1139 for (auto secondaryCmdBuffer : cb_node->linkedCommandBuffers) { in GpuPostCallQueueSubmit()
1169 auto cb_node = GetCBNode(cmd_buffer); in GpuAllocateValidationResources() local
1170 if (!cb_node) { in GpuAllocateValidationResources()
1187 cb_node->gpu_buffer_list.emplace_back(block, desc_sets[0], desc_pool); in GpuAllocateValidationResources()
1201 …auto iter = cb_node->lastBound.find(VK_PIPELINE_BIND_POINT_GRAPHICS); // find() allows read-only … in GpuAllocateValidationResources()
1202 if (iter != cb_node->lastBound.end()) { in GpuAllocateValidationResources()